LAYERED COLE SLAW
1 head red cabbage, shredded
1 sweet onion, sliced thinly
1 green pepper, sliced thinly
1/4 cup sugar
Juice from 1 lemon
Juice from 1 orange
1 tsp. salt
1/2 tsp. celery seed
1 tsp. dry mustard powder
1/2 cup canola oil
In large glass bowl, layer cabbage, onion and green pepper.
Combine remaining ingredients in small glass jar, shake and mix well. Pour over vegetables but do not mix or toss. Cover and refrigerate overnight.
Just before serving, toss well.
Makes 8 servings
Source: Sunkist
